What is a Dog Pregnancy Timeline Calculator?

A Dog Pregnancy Timeline Calculator is a tool designed to help pet owners estimate the stages of their dog's pregnancy. By inputting the date of mating or the dog's heat cycle, the calculator provides an estimated timeline for key events such as whelping (giving birth), prenatal care, and more.

Common Mistakes When Using the Dog Pregnancy Timeline Calculator

  • Incorrect Dates: Entering the wrong mating date can lead to significant inaccuracies.
  • Ignoring Heat Cycles: Not accounting for irregular heat cycles can skew results.
  • Overlooking Breeding Methods: Different breeding methods (natural vs. artificial insemination) can affect timing.
  • Assuming All Breeds are the Same: Different dog breeds can have varying gestation periods.

Interpretation Pitfalls: Misunderstanding the Results

One of the most common pitfalls is misinterpreting the output from the calculator. For example, if the calculator indicates a whelping date, it is crucial to understand that this is an estimate, not a guarantee. Factors such as the dog's health, breed, and environment can influence actual outcomes.

Frequently Asked Questions

What should I do if my dog misses her due date?

If your dog misses her due date, consult your veterinarian immediately to check for any complications.

Can I use the calculator for all dog breeds?

Yes, but remember that some breeds may have slightly different gestation lengths.

How accurate is the Dog Pregnancy Timeline Calculator?

The calculator provides estimates based on average gestation periods, but individual results may vary.

What factors can affect my dog's pregnancy timeline?

Health, breed, age, and the method of mating can all impact the pregnancy timeline.

Should I take my dog to the vet during her pregnancy?

Yes! Regular veterinary check-ups are essential for monitoring the health of both the mother and her puppies.
